引言:火山引擎助力Python脚本高效运行
在云计算时代,如何在云端快速部署并运行Python脚本成为开发者关注的重点。火山引擎作为字节跳动旗下的云服务平台,凭借其高性能计算资源、弹性扩展能力和丰富的运维工具,为开发者提供了便捷的Python脚本运行环境。本文将详细介绍如何在火山引擎云服务器上运行Python脚本,并深入解析其技术优势。
快速创建云服务器实例
登录火山引擎控制台后,开发者可在「云服务器」模块快速创建ecs实例:
1. 选择适合Python计算的实例类型(如通用型g1系列)
2. 配置SSH密钥对实现安全登录
3. 根据需求选择预装CentOS或Ubuntu系统镜像
火山引擎提供分钟级实例创建能力,支持按需付费和预留实例组合使用,大幅降低计算成本。
智能化环境配置
通过火山引擎提供的初始化脚本功能,可自动完成环境部署:
bash
# 示例:自动化安装Python环境
sudo apt-get update
sudo apt-get install python3-pip -y
pip3 install -r requirements.txt
平台内置的云监控服务实时跟踪cpu/内存使用率,当Python脚本需要更多资源时,可自动触发弹性扩容策略。

安全高效的文件传输
火山引擎提供多种文件传输方案:
- 通过内置的SFTP服务直接上传脚本文件
- 使用对象存储TOS作为中转仓库
- 集成GitLab代码仓库自动同步
传输过程全程SSL加密,配合网络ACL防火墙规则,确保开发数据安全。
全生命周期管理能力
火山引擎的运维优势在脚本运行阶段尤为突出:
1. 通过云助手功能批量管理多台服务器
2. 使用日志服务CLS收集Python运行时日志
3. 配置报警规则监控脚本运行状态
支持创建定时任务实现脚本自动化执行,配合工作流编排实现复杂业务逻辑。
典型应用场景实践
案例一:分布式爬虫系统
利用火山引擎弹性IP和负载均衡服务,搭建分布式爬虫集群,自动扩展计算节点应对流量高峰。
案例二:机器学习模型训练
使用GPU加速型实例运行TensorFlow/PyTorch脚本,配合文件存储NAS实现训练数据共享。
案例三:自动化运维系统
基于火山引擎API开发运维脚本,实现资源监控、费用分析等自动化操作。
持续优化与成本控制
火山引擎提供多维度的成本管理工具:
- 资源组功能实现项目级成本核算
- 闲置资源检测自动释放冗余实例
- 费用中心生成Python脚本运行成本报告
结合预留实例券和竞价实例,可将计算成本降低最高70%。
总结:火山引擎的Python开发新体验
从环境搭建到脚本部署,从安全防护到运维监控,火山引擎为Python开发者打造了全链路解决方案。其核心优势体现在:
1. 毫秒级资源响应速度提升部署效率
2. 智能弹性伸缩应对计算负载波动
3. 企业级安全架构保障数据资产
4. 精细化成本管理优化IT支出
建议开发者充分利用火山引擎的OpenAPI生态和丰富的开发者工具,构建更智能的云上Python应用体系。

kf@jusoucn.com
4008-020-360


4008-020-360
